Valentine’s Day decor can go from charming to a lot pretty quickly, which is why tiered trays have become the low-commitment, high-impact favorite for people who like their seasonal touches subtle and cute.
A tray gives you just enough space to play with color, texture, and tiny themed accents without taking over your whole apartment or feeling like you raided the craft aisle on impulse.

I’ve come to love them as a small-space hack—they’re easy to style, even easier to update, and perfect if you want your home to feel festive without going full rom-com set design.
In the spirit of keeping things sweet but still elevated, here are 13 Valentine’s Day tiered tray decor ideas that blend charm, warmth, and a little personality.
1. Red Truck & XOXO Tray

A mix of classic red Valentine icons, a whipped-cream-topped mug, and a friendly little gnome gives this tray a cheerful, nostalgic vibe—like a mini Valentine village right on your counter.
2. Soft Pastel Candy Hearts Tray

With pastel Rae Dunn pieces, heart-shaped measuring spoons, and a dish of candy hearts, this design nails the quiet, cozy side of Valentine’s décor—cute, calm, and effortlessly coordinated.
3. Pink & Playful Valentine Tray

This tray mixes soft pink accents, heart garlands, and sweet details like a “Love Potion” cut-out, creating a playful setup that still feels tidy and intentionally styled.
4. Vintage Valentine Charm Tray

From pastel glassware to retro figurines and old-school Valentine cards, this tray brings nostalgic charm in the sweetest, most curated way.

5. Minimalist Cocoa & Sweetheart Tray

Clean, simple Rae Dunn pieces paired with a few red accents keep this tray feeling minimal but still perfectly on-theme for Valentine’s Day.
6. Gnome & Hearts Pop Tray

With bold heart accents, fluffy red-and-white stems, and a pink Valentine gnome, this tray delivers fun, festive energy with zero effort required.
7. Cottagecore Valentine Village Tray

Tiny houses, cute cupcakes, and a knit pom-pom hat make this tray feel like a cute little Valentine village—cozy, handmade, and full of personality.
8. Mr. & Mrs. Valentine Tray

This playful setup uses couples’ mugs, heart lights, and sweet signage to create a themed display that’s ideal for celebrating Valentine’s Day with your partner.
9. Cupid’s Sweet Shop Tray

If you love the dessert-themed decor trend, this one’s a standout—cupcakes, chocolates, macarons, and a tiny mixer turn your tray into an adorable mini bake shop.
10. Rustic Florals & Candlelight Tray

A mix of wood slices, glowing candles, and soft florals creates a rustic-romantic tray that feels warm, welcoming, and perfect for a cozy corner table.
11. Soft & Simple Pink Baking Tray

Soft pinks, tiny rolling pins, and a sweet “Happy Valentine’s Day” sign make this design perfect for anyone who loves a subtle, baking-inspired aesthetic.
12. Whimsical Love-Themed Tray

Packed with felt hearts, mini banners, and playful touches like XO blocks and strawberry accents, this tray brings a sweet storybook vibe that feels cheerful without becoming cluttered.
13. Classic Red & White Cottage Tray

This tiered tray leans into a charming cottage feel with heart-patterned mugs, mini houses, and frosted greenery—proof that classic red and white can still feel fresh when layered with texture.
Tiered trays really are one of the easiest ways to bring a little Valentine’s charm into your home without committing to a full-on décor overhaul.
A few mini signs, a pop of pink or red, and one or two statement pieces are often all you need to make a corner of your kitchen or entryway feel instantly sweeter.
